Collier-Seminole State Park
Royal Palm Hammock, Florida, United States
Collier-Seminole State Park offers paddling access in Florida's Royal Palm Hammock area, located in southwestern Florida near Naples. The park provides parking facilities for visitors arriving to explore the water-based recreation opportunities in this region.
A play spot is available at this location, making it suitable for paddlers looking to practice skills or enjoy recreational paddling in a designated area. The park's facilities support day-use activities for those interested in exploring the waterways of the Ten Thousand Islands ecosystem.
The site serves as a launch point for paddlers seeking to experience Florida's coastal and mangrove environments. With parking available and a play spot for water recreation, the location accommodates both experienced and novice paddlers looking to access the natural waterways in this part of southwest Florida.
